The Backtalk Eye & Cheek Palette. This is the palette that everyone is going crazy over. Named and inspired after the No. 1 selling Backtalk Comfort Matte Vice Lipstick shade, it is a veritable love fest to the color rose. It is a palette that ANYONE can wear. Yes, I said anyone. Let me tell you this is HOT!!!! It is gorgeous. And it is something you need.

Like two palettes in one, this travel-ready case holds eight nude-mauve, soft berry and muted rose eye shadow shades on one side and four coordinating shades of blush and highlighter on the other. This is one of the big trends for spring. These shades are universally flattering on any skin tone. It has a removable double-sided mirror in the middle. So you can see yourself while you put on your fabulous makeup at home, while in an UBER or in the club. the shadows are just as advanced as the packaging: every shade features Urban Decay's proprietary Pigment Infusion System™ for velvety pigments that blend easily, stay rich and last for hours. 

Here are the eye shadow shades in the palette:
  • 3 SHEETS (pale pink-nude matte)
  • BARE (light pinky-peach satin)
  • CURVE (metallic rose shimmer with silver micro-glitter)
  • ATTITUDE (metallic red-copper)
  • BACKTALK (soft rosy mauve matte)
  • WTF (reddish brown matte)
  • SHADE (deep fuchsia satin)
  • 180 (metallic brown-red)
Here are the cheek/highlighter shades in the palette:
  • DOUBLE TAKE (rich mauve with slight shimmer)
  • LOW KEY (pink-peach)
  • CHEAP SHOT (medium pink-nude)
  • PARTY FOUL (light pink-nude shimmer)

You can see how 3 Sheets is so pale that it barely shows up on my skin, but that doesn't mean it isn't pigmented. It is, it is just light. It is definitely a great color and would look beautiful on dark skin or as a lid color. 

Here are two different looks I did with the palette. I think the colors look really good on me. Not bragging, just saying that with my coloring these are good colors for my complexion, hair color and eyes. I love the roses and mauves.





 For this look I used the following: Urban Decay All Nighter Foundation in 0.5, Backtalk Eye & Cheek Palette (Shade in crease, 180 in transition, Attitude on lower lid, Curve on upper lid and 3 Sheets under brow); Zero 24/7 Glide-On Eye Pencil on upper lid; Troublemaker Mascara on lashes; Low Key and Cheap Shot on cheeks; Backtalk Vice Lipstick on lips.


Here is another look I did with the palette:

 Here is what I used to achieve this look: IT Cosmetics Celebration Foundation Illumination in Fair; Urban Decay Backtalk Eye & Cheek Palette (Shade in crease, WTF in transition and lining lower lids, Bare on upper lids, 3 Sheets under brow), Double Take and Party Foul on cheeks, Hi-Fi Shine Ultra Cushion Lipgloss in Dirtytalk on lips; L’OrĂ©al Paris Lash Paradise Mascara in Black; essence cosmetics rock n’ roll duo stylist eyeliner pen.

I adore this palette. I think that this has to be my favorite Urban Decay palette even next to Naked 3. MORE than Naked 3. It has colors that really suit anyone's features and is just about perfect. The palette itself is very inexpensive when you think about how much you get in it. You get eight eyeshadows and four blushes/highlighters. That is such a good deal! And they are Urban Decay!!!
